Sky Sands is the third course in theAir Ride mode ofKirby Air Ride, also available as an unlockable course inKirby Air Riders. It is a compact and winding track set amid floating ruins, flowing sand dunes, and fossilized coral beds and features many tight turns, moving parts, and hidden passageways. It has an appreciable though slightly shorter length, and the default number of laps run on it is two.
Overview[edit]

Track[edit]
Sky Sands runs on a clockwise course around a very warped track with many large bends and tight turns, though only a small amount of verticality is present. The starting line is located at the top of the track in the middle of the flat lane toward the right. After leaping off a short cliff and passing through some light dunes, the racers must make a near-180 degree turn to the right to head down another roadway leading through a small oasis area. After passing a rounded bend to the left, the track goes through a stony cave with sand falling from the ceiling. The main path is just ahead, but there is a small shortcut that can be found through the falling sand at the back to the right. After another turn, the path briefly splits into an upper and lower deck, the upper of which can be accessed by jumping off a scuttling sand crab on the road.
The path then moves around a large stone sun sculpture then bends to the right to pass through a road studded with rotating elements. The road bends three times along several conveyors around a moon statue. From there, the path swerves around a ruined pillar, though there is a floor panel just before the bend that can be activated to reveal a trap door that goes directly beneath the pillar and contains aDash Panel. After another turn to the right, the racers move through more dunes and sand waves before reaching two spinning wheels of stone that bounce them onto higher platforms. After traversing more wide bends lined with fossilized coral, the finish line can be reached back at the start after passing by some pillars that fall onto the track as the racers approach.
Setting and enemies[edit]
Sky Sands is set, appropriately, in a floating sandy desert high in the sky. The course is riddled with lots of little details and areas, including giant arching formations that resemble a giant fossil rib cage, green succulent plants in a small oasis region, and charismatic ruins built of sandstone. As mentioned above, along the way, a set of giant statues can be found that resemble the sun and moon, and there are beds of fossilized coral reefs. Overall, the track has a very similar appearance to some of the locales ofRock Star fromKirby 64: The Crystal Shards.
There are relatively few enemies on this track compared to other courses, but the main ability-granting foes that appear here areWheelie,Sword Knight, andPichikuri, withCaller,Balloon Bomber,Heat Phanphan, andWalky being comparatively rarer.
Checklist objectives[edit]
Kirby Air Ride[edit]
The following are all of thechecklist objectives that specifically pertain to Sky Sands inKirby Air Ride:
| Objective | Reward |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| Air Ride: SKY SANDS Finish 2 laps in under 01:45:00! | None | |
| Air Ride: SKY SANDS Finish 2 laps in under 02:05:00! | Machine:Swerve Star | |
| Air Ride: SKY SANDS Race over 4,000 feet in 2 minutes! | None | Must be done in Time mode, rather than Laps mode. |
| Free Run: SKY SANDS Do 1 lap under 01:05:00 onBulk Star! | Color:Brown Kirby | |
| Free Run: SKY SANDS Finish 1 lap in under 00:53:00! | None | |
| Free Run: SKY SANDS Finish 1 lap in under 01:05:00! | None | |
| SKY SANDS: Break all of the coral and finish in 1st place! | One free box filler | All coral must be broken by the player. |
| SKY SANDS: Enter the quicksand 3 times and finish in 1st place! | None | 'Quicksand' refers to the falling sand inside the cave. Must pass through exactly 3 times and then finish. |
| SKY SANDS: Open the trapdoor exactly 3 times and finish in 1st place! | Music:Kirby Super Star: The Arena | Alternative music for the course Sky Sands. Original track ofThe Arena battle theme fromKirby Super Star. |
| Time Attack: SKY SANDS Finish in under 02:40:00! | None | |
| Time Attack: SKY SANDS Finish in under 02:40:00 onWagon Star! | None | |
| Time Attack: SKY SANDS Finish in under 03:10:00! | Music:Air Ride: Sky Sands |
Kirby Air Riders[edit]
The following are all of thechecklist objectives that specifically pertain to Sky Sands inKirby Air Riders:
| Objective | Reward |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| Air Ride: Sky Sands Open the door hidden underground | License Card: Sticker | Sticker of generic sparkles |
| Air Ride: Sky Sands Take the ruins byroad hidden behind the sand | License Card: Sticker | Adoor with five surrounding stars. |
| Air Ride: Sky Sands (Time) Complete a lap within 0:50.00 | My Machine Parts: Decal | A red tulip. |
| Air Ride: Sky Sands Break 2 pieces of coral and complete a lap | License Card: Sticker | Bandana Waddle Dee thrusting a spear. |
| Air Ride: Sky Sands (Laps) Finish without crashing into any enemies | Alt Music: Air Ride Sky Sands (Alt) | |
| Air Ride: Sky Sands Ride over 4 dash zones and complete a lap without reversing | Street Name (First Half): "Sky Sands" |

Names in other languages[edit]
Kirby Air Ride[edit]
| Language | Name | Meaning |
|---|---|---|
| Japanese | サンドーラ Sandōra | Sandoola Taken from in-game in the Japanese version upon starting the course. Corruption of "sand", and may involve空 (sora), "sky". |
| French | Sky Sands | - |
| German | Sky Sands | - |
| Italian | Sky Sands | - |
| Spanish | Sky Sands | - |
Kirby Air Riders[edit]
| Language | Name | Meaning |
|---|---|---|
| Japanese | サンドーラ Sandōra | Sandoola |
| Chinese | 流沙荒漠 Liúshā Huāngmò | Quicksand Desert |
| Dutch | Hemelhoge Zandweg | Sky-high Sand Road |
| French | Sables aériens | Aerial sands |
| German | Wolkendünen | Cloud Dunes |
| Italian | Dune celesti | Celestial dunes |
| Korean | 샌드라 saendeura | Sandra |
| Portuguese | Areias Celestes | Celestial Sands |
| Spanish | Arenas Celestes | Celestial Sands |
